2. AWD Capabilities

All-wheel drive (AWD) represents a critical feature for the 2025 Cadillac XT4 Sport AWD SUV, directly impacting vehicle performance, handling, and overall safety. The inclusion of AWD necessitates a comprehensive understanding of its functionalities and benefits within the context of this specific vehicle model.

  • Enhanced Traction and Stability

    The primary function of AWD is to improve traction and stability, particularly in adverse weather conditions such as rain, snow, or ice. By distributing power to all four wheels, the system mitigates the risk of wheel slippage and loss of control. For the 2025 Cadillac XT4 Sport AWD SUV, this translates to a more secure and confident driving experience, especially in regions with variable climate conditions. The system dynamically adjusts torque distribution based on sensor inputs, optimizing grip and minimizing the potential for skidding or loss of directional control.

  • Improved Performance on Varied Terrain

    AWD enhances the vehicle’s capability on a variety of terrains beyond paved roads. While the XT4 is not designed for extreme off-roading, the AWD system provides added confidence on gravel roads, unpaved surfaces, or moderately uneven terrain. This capability broadens the vehicle’s usability and appeal for drivers who require a degree of versatility beyond typical urban driving. The system’s ability to maintain traction on less-than-ideal surfaces contributes to a more stable and predictable driving experience.

  • Dynamic Torque Distribution

    Modern AWD systems, such as the one expected in the 2025 Cadillac XT4 Sport AWD SUV, incorporate dynamic torque distribution. This means the system continuously monitors wheel speeds, throttle position, and other factors to optimize power delivery to each wheel individually. By precisely controlling torque distribution, the system enhances handling and stability during cornering, acceleration, and braking. This sophisticated control system helps to maintain optimal traction and minimize understeer or oversteer, leading to a more balanced and controlled driving experience.

  • Integration with Electronic Stability Control

    The AWD system works in conjunction with the vehicle’s electronic stability control (ESC) system. ESC utilizes sensors to detect and mitigate potential skids or loss of control. When ESC detects wheel slip, it can selectively apply braking force to individual wheels and reduce engine power to help the driver maintain control. The synergistic effect of AWD and ESC provides a comprehensive safety net, enhancing stability and minimizing the risk of accidents, particularly in challenging driving conditions. The combined system offers a higher level of safety and control compared to vehicles equipped with only one of these technologies.

6. Safety Features

The inclusion of comprehensive safety features is a critical element in the design and marketing of the 2025 Cadillac XT4 Sport AWD SUV. These features are not merely accessories but integral components that contribute to occupant protection and accident avoidance, thereby influencing purchasing decisions and overall vehicle appeal.

  • Advanced Driver-Assistance Systems (ADAS) Integration

    The 2025 Cadillac XT4 Sport AWD SUV likely incorporates a suite of Advanced Driver-Assistance Systems (ADAS) designed to mitigate the risk of collisions and enhance driver awareness. Examples of such systems include Automatic Emergency Braking (AEB), which can autonomously apply the brakes to prevent or reduce the severity of a frontal impact; Lane Keeping Assist (LKA), which helps the driver maintain the vehicle’s position within the lane; and Blind Spot Monitoring (BSM), which alerts the driver to the presence of vehicles in adjacent lanes. These ADAS functionalities directly contribute to accident prevention and reduced injury severity in the event of a collision. The effectiveness of these systems is dependent on sensor accuracy, processing speed, and the system’s ability to interpret and react to real-world driving scenarios.

  • Structural Integrity and Crashworthiness

    The structural design of the 2025 Cadillac XT4 Sport AWD SUV plays a crucial role in occupant protection during a collision. The vehicle’s frame and body are engineered to absorb and dissipate impact energy, minimizing the forces transmitted to the passenger compartment. High-strength steel and advanced manufacturing techniques are often employed to enhance the vehicle’s crashworthiness. Independent testing by organizations such as the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) and the Insurance Institute for Highway Safety (IIHS) assesses the vehicle’s performance in various crash scenarios, providing consumers with objective data on its structural safety. Good crash test ratings are a significant factor in consumer perception of vehicle safety.

  • Airbag Systems and Restraint Technology

    The airbag system within the 2025 Cadillac XT4 Sport AWD SUV provides a crucial layer of protection in the event of a collision. Modern airbag systems include frontal airbags, side-impact airbags, and side curtain airbags, designed to deploy and cushion occupants during a crash. The effectiveness of airbags is contingent on proper seatbelt usage. Advanced seatbelt technologies, such as pretensioners and load limiters, work in conjunction with the airbag system to minimize occupant movement and reduce the risk of injury. The placement and deployment characteristics of the airbags are carefully engineered to provide optimal protection for occupants of varying sizes and seating positions.

  • Active Safety Features and Stability Control

    Active safety features are designed to prevent accidents from occurring in the first place. The 2025 Cadillac XT4 Sport AWD SUV incorporates an Electronic Stability Control (ESC) system, which helps the driver maintain control of the vehicle during emergency maneuvers or on slippery surfaces. ESC utilizes sensors to detect wheel slip and selectively applies braking force to individual wheels to correct understeer or oversteer. Traction control systems also work in conjunction with ESC to prevent wheel spin during acceleration, enhancing stability and control. These active safety features contribute to a more secure and predictable driving experience, particularly in challenging road conditions. The AWD system further enhances traction and stability, especially in adverse weather conditions.

7. Fuel Efficiency

Fuel efficiency represents a critical performance parameter for the 2025 Cadillac XT4 Sport AWD SUV, directly influencing its operational costs and environmental impact. Its significance stems from a combination of economic considerations and increasing regulatory pressures related to fuel consumption and emissions. Lower fuel consumption translates directly to reduced expenses for the vehicle owner, while simultaneously contributing to lower overall greenhouse gas emissions. The vehicle’s design and engineering, including engine technology, weight management, and aerodynamic properties, all contribute to its fuel efficiency. Failure to achieve competitive fuel economy within its class could negatively impact consumer perception and sales figures.

The AWD system, while enhancing traction and handling, inherently contributes to increased fuel consumption compared to a two-wheel-drive configuration due to the added weight and drivetrain friction. Therefore, achieving acceptable fuel efficiency in the 2025 Cadillac XT4 Sport AWD SUV necessitates a balance between performance and economy. For instance, advanced engine technologies such as turbocharging, direct injection, and cylinder deactivation might be employed to optimize power output while minimizing fuel consumption. Furthermore, the integration of an automatic transmission with a wide gear ratio spread and optimized shift strategies can also contribute to improved fuel efficiency. The vehicle’s aerodynamic profile, including the design of the front fascia, underbody panels, and rear spoiler, also plays a role in reducing drag and improving fuel economy at highway speeds.
